How much does it cost to rent an apartment in North Waterfront?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| North Waterfront Studio Apartments | $3,485 | $1,200 | $5,130 |
| North Waterfront 1 Bedroom Apartments | $5,016 | $2,850 | $7,938 |
| North Waterfront 2 Bedroom Apartments | $8,604 | $6,749 | $10,000+ |
| North Waterfront 3 Bedroom Apartments | $13,137 | $8,395 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about North Waterfront
What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the North Waterfront area of San Francisco, CA?
As of today, August 13, 2026, there are currently 1,891 available North Waterfront apartments priced from $1,200 to $25,206, with an average monthly rent of $6,855.
How much are Studio apartments in North Waterfront?
There are currently 1,106 Studio Apartments in North Waterfront with rent ranges from $1,200 to $5,130 with an average price of $3,485.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om North Waterfront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in North Waterfront ranges from $2,850 to $7,938 with an average monthly rent of $5,016.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in North Waterfront c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in North Waterfront range from $6,749 to $12,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$8,604.
How expensive are North Waterfront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 216 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in North Waterfront on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$8,395 to $25,206 - averaging $13,137 for the location.
